Responsibilities

Design, implement, and/or test software and requirements for use in real-time embedded aircraft control systems
Perform systems and software integration and verification activities using real and simulated hardware
Develop maintainable computer interfaces to electrical and mechanical systems, including hardware drivers and communication protocols
Comply with flight or safety critical processes such as DO-178C Level A or SAE ARP4754A or military aircraft equivalent
Stay up to date on advances in technology and processes for continuous improvement of accuracy, reliability, and cost
Create and update AI scripts and tools
Champion AI awareness, buy-in, and adoption readiness
Stay abreast of industry trends and emerging AI technologies
Contribute to best practices for AI model development, testing, and deployment
Collaborate with engineering teams to architect scalable, secure AI solutions within existing enterprise systems
